Install Pupil Labs on Ubuntu
- Download the Pupil Labs Capture & Player from the Pupil Labs [github] (https://github.com/pupil-labs/pupil/releases)
- Open the .deb files and click install
Opening/Using Pupil Labs Capture
- Click on the Pupil Capture icon
- Connect head camera via USB port
- Click the 'C' on screen to run a calibration test
- Click the 'R' on screen to start recording
Opening/Using Pupil Labs Player
- Make a recording using Pupil Labs Capture
- Click on the Pupil Player icon
- Go to Desktop
- Click on Files
- Click on recordings
- Select date the recording was made
- Drag desired recording folder onto the Pupil Player window
- Click the 'P' on screen to start playing recording
